发明名称 SPREAD SPECTRUM CLOCK GENERATOR, ELECTRONIC APPARATUS, AND SPREAD SPECTRUM CLOCK GENERATION METHOD
摘要 A spread spectrum clock generator includes a phase comparator that compares a reference clock with a feedback clock, a low-pass filter that passes a predetermined low-frequency component, a phase lock loop that includes a voltage-controlled oscillator generating an output clock whose frequency corresponds to the filtered signal, a triangular wave controller that generates a triangular wave signal for frequency-modulating the spread spectrum clock based on the output clock, a delay controller that generates the feedback clock by controlling delay of the output clock based on the triangular wave signal, a first counter that counts the output clock and output a first count value, a second counter that counts the reference clock and output a second count value, and a phase error correction circuit that compares the first count value with the second count value and corrects phase error of the output clock.

主权项 1. A spread spectrum clock generator, comprising: a phase comparator to compare a reference clock with a feedback clock to obtain a comparison result; a low-pass filter to pass a predetermined low-frequency component from a signal of the comparison result to obtain a filtered signal; a phase lock loop including a voltage-controlled oscillator that generates an output clock whose frequency corresponds to the filtered signal; a triangular wave controller to generate a triangular wave signal for frequency-modulating the spread spectrum clock based on the output clock; a delay controller to generate the feedback clock by controlling delay of the output clock based on the triangular wave signal; a first counter to count the output clock to output a first count value; a second counter to count the reference clock to output a second count value; and a phase error correction circuit to compare the first count value with the second count value for period that is a cycle or a multiple of the cycle of the frequency modulation and correct phase error of the output clock by modifying a shape of the triangular wave signal so that the first count value matches the second count value based on the comparison result.
